How To Post Photos To A Wall

I get asked by quite a many people how do I post photos to my wall without using outside imaging websites and I am here to answer that!

The first thing to do is make sure your photo is the correct size! For walls the photos are required to be smaller than what you can on a normal post. Under five hundred is what I have found to be acceptable :)! Do not know how to resize your photos then I have a great suggestion for you! Download Photoscape, it is a free simple to use image editing program. It has a resizing option that will allow your photo to be downsized without distorting it. Just google photoscape cnet and it will more than likely be the result on the top :)!



If you are doing screen shots for example say by using the print screen function I generally will paste them into the basic paint program found on most computers, save it as is then open it with photoscape to further edit the image.

Now that you have your photo resized and ready, open up two tabs in your browser. One tab being the wall you want to post the photo to be on and the other tab opening to the discussion area of the forums. Find a post, any post will do.
